The exits 33

The companies built in Ahmedabad that were bought, who bought them, and for how much, from a web-summariser sold to Intel's Kno in 2013 to a skincare brand sold to Wipro in 2026.

  1. Cruxbot
    Bought by
    Kno, then Intel
    When
    May 2013
    For
    Undisclosed

    Nirmit Parikh built Cruxlight in 2012, a tool that summarised any web page the way a book summary stands in for a book, with Tanmay Desai as co-founder. Within a year Kno, the Silicon Valley education company, bought it for an undisclosed sum, and in November 2013 Intel bought Kno. Parikh went on to set up Intel's first office in Ahmedabad, and later founded apna, the jobs platform.

  2. Cyberoam
    Bought by
    Sophos
    When
    February 2014
    For
    Undisclosed

    Cyberoam was Elitecore's network security business, spun out as its own company with the Carlyle Group behind it: firewalls and unified threat management appliances with identity-based policies, sold through 5,500 resellers in more than 125 countries. When the British security company Sophos bought it on 10 February 2014 the company had more than 550 people, with R&D and global support run from its head office off Panchvati Cross Road. Terms were not disclosed. Sophos kept the office, which is registered today as Sophos Technologies.

  3. Elitecore Technologies
    Bought by
    Sterlite Technologies
    When
    September 2015
    For
    About Rs 180 crore

    Elitecore started in 1999 and grew into a telecom software company: billing, revenue management and operations support for operators, with more than 700 people across India, Southeast Asia, the UAE and Africa. Its security division had already left as Cyberoam. On 30 September 2015 Sterlite Technologies completed the purchase of the whole company from First Carlyle Ventures and the other shareholders, an all-cash deal reported at around Rs 180 crore ($27.3 million), to put software beside its optical fibre business.

  4. DRC Systems
    Bought by
    Infibeam
    When
    March 2017
    For
    Rs 6 crore

    DRC Systems built custom software and cloud ERP for e-commerce businesses: 200 engineers on proprietary and open source frameworks, profitable, and past Rs 10 crore in revenue. Infibeam, the Ahmedabad e-commerce company that had listed the year before, had been using DRC to customise its BuildaBazaar storefronts for merchants, and in March 2017 bought the company outright for Rs 6 crore in cash. DRC Systems India is a listed company in its own right today, registered at GIFT City.

  5. Beardo
    Bought by
    Marico
    When
    2017 to 2020
    For
    Rs 50 crore for the first 45%

    Ashutosh Valani and Priyank Shah started Beardo in Ahmedabad as a men's grooming brand, beard oils and washes sold online first. Marico, the Parachute and Saffola company, took 45% of the parent Zed Lifestyle in March 2017 for about Rs 50 crore, and in July 2020 bought the remaining 55%, making Beardo a wholly owned subsidiary. It ran from an office in Shapath V on the SG Highway, opposite Karnavati Club.

  6. Claris Injectables
    Bought by
    Baxter
    When
    July 2017
    For
    About $625 million

    Claris Lifesciences was the city's generic injectables company: anaesthesia, renal, anti-infective and critical care medicines in bags, vials and ampoules, with 11 molecules approved in the United States, its own R&D and three plants. In December 2016 Baxter, the American hospital products company, agreed to buy the injectables subsidiary, and the deal closed on 27 July 2017 for about $625 million, taking on the plants, the pipeline and more than $100 million of annual revenue.

  7. Havmor Ice Cream
    Bought by
    Lotte Confectionery
    When
    November 2017
    For
    Rs 1,020 crore

    Havmor began as a small ice cream business in 1944 and came to Ahmedabad with the Chona family after Partition, growing over three generations into a brand with around 160 products, parlours across 14 states and factories in Ahmedabad and Faridabad. In November 2017 South Korea's Lotte Confectionery bought the whole ice cream company for Rs 1,020 crore (about $158 million), its way into India's ice cream market.

  8. eInfochips
    Bought by
    Arrow Electronics
    When
    January 2018
    For
    $327.6 million

    Pratul Shroff, a chip designer who had worked at Intel, founded eInfochips in Ahmedabad in 1994 to do semiconductor design and product engineering for companies elsewhere. By the time Arrow Electronics, the American components distributor, bought it in January 2018 it had 1,500 people, offices in San Jose, India and Europe, and customers across the life of a product, from custom hardware to connected devices. Arrow's own filings put the price at $327.6 million. It runs today as eInfochips, an Arrow company.

  9. Educational Initiatives
    Bought by
    Gaja Capital, a majority
    When
    July 2018
    For
    $25 million

    Srini Raghavan, Sridhar Rajagopalan, Sudhir Ghodke and Venkat Krishnan started Educational Initiatives in 2001 to find out what children actually understand: the ASSET diagnostic tests and the Mindspark adaptive learning programme came out of it. In July 2018 the private equity firm Gaja Capital paid $25 million for a majority of the company, an exit for its founders and early backers. In March 2024 HCL Group bought a minority stake from Gaja for Rs 166 crore.

  10. Brillare Science
    Bought by
    Emami
    When
    2018 to 2024
    Stake
    26% to 100%

    Jigar Patel, a pharmacist who had run R&D at Lincoln Pharmaceuticals, started Brillare in 2010 to make professional hair and skin care for salons, sold under Brillare and Root Deep. Emami, the Kolkata FMCG company, took 26% in 2018 as its way into the salon segment, raised its holding in stages, and in March 2024 bought the last 4.64%, making Brillare a wholly owned subsidiary. The brand still runs from its office near the High Court on the SG Highway.

  11. Softweb Solutions
    Bought by
    Avnet
    When
    December 2018
    For
    Undisclosed

    Ripal Vyas built Softweb into a software and AI company for the Internet of Things, connecting factories, fleets and devices to the applications that read them, with its engineering in Ahmedabad. When Avnet, the American electronics distributor, agreed to buy it in December 2018, Softweb had about 500 people in Dallas, Chicago and Ahmedabad. Terms were not disclosed; Avnet said the deal would add software and AI to its IoT business and add to earnings from the first year.

  12. Evosys
    Bought by
    Mastek
    When
    February 2020
    For
    $65 million for the Middle East arm

    Evolutionary Systems, Evosys, became a large Oracle Cloud implementation partner from Ahmedabad: 13 years of ERP work and more than 1,000 Oracle Cloud customers in over 30 countries. In February 2020 Mastek, the Mumbai IT company, agreed to take the whole business: the India, US, UK and rest-of-world operations merged into a Mastek subsidiary, and Mastek UK paid $65 million in cash for the Middle East arm. The Evosys promoters came out holding 15% of Mastek.

  13. Byte Prophecy
    Bought by
    Accenture
    When
    May 2020
    For
    Undisclosed

    Mrugank Parikh, Adityavijay Rathore, Darshit Shah and Manish Patil started Byte Prophecy in 2011 as a bootstrapped analytics company, automating the insights that large companies pull from their data. In May 2020 Accenture bought it and folded its nearly 50 data scientists and data engineers into Accenture Applied Intelligence. Terms were not disclosed.

  14. Vini Cosmetics
    Bought by
    KKR, a 54% stake
    When
    June 2021
    For
    $625 million

    Darshan Patel had built Moov, Krack and Itch Guard at Paras Pharmaceuticals, the Ahmedabad family business he sold his stake in, before starting Vini Cosmetics in 2010; Fogg came out in 2011, a deodorant sold on 800 sprays and no gas in the can. In June 2021 the American private equity firm KKR paid $625 million (about Rs 4,600 crore) for a 54% stake from the founder family and Sequoia, valuing Vini at $1.2 billion, reported at the time as the largest private equity investment in Indian FMCG. Darshan Patel stayed on as chairman.

  15. Vendaxo
    Bought by
    Moglix
    When
    July 2021
    For
    Undisclosed

    Nirat Patel and Poonam Choudhary started Vendaxo in 2016 out of VentureStudio at Ahmedabad University: a marketplace where factories sell the machines they no longer need, with Siemens, Arvind, Marico, Raymond and Torrent Pharma among the sellers. In July 2021, soon after becoming a unicorn, the B2B commerce company Moglix bought it to give manufacturers a way to buy capital goods second-hand. Terms were not disclosed.

  16. Pedagogy
    Bought by
    Vedantu
    When
    July 2021
    For
    About Rs 28.5 crore

    Archin Shah and his co-founders started Pedagogy in Ahmedabad in 2016, an e-learning platform for students preparing for competitive exams, and it had raised $400,000 before the pandemic put every classroom online. In July 2021 Vedantu, the Bengaluru live-tutoring company, agreed to buy the whole company in tranches: the promoters, who held 75%, received Rs 21.4 crore, Rs 15.23 crore of it in cash and the rest in Vedantu shares, and the full acquisition was priced at around Rs 28.5 crore.

  17. Puniska Healthcare
    Bought by
    Amneal Pharmaceuticals
    When
    November 2021
    For
    About Rs 700 crore

    Puniska built a 293,000 square foot sterile injectables plant in Ahmedabad, with robotic and aseptic vial lines, an emulsion line and a large-volume bag line, in a company only four years old. In November 2021 Amneal, the American generics maker, bought it for about $93 million, taking on 550 people and the capacity to make injectables for the United States, with the plant as its base for markets beyond.

  18. Mush
    Bought by
    GlobalBees
    When
    January 2022
    For
    Undisclosed

    Ayush Agarwal and Nihar Gosalia left corporate jobs in 2018 to sell bamboo towels online, softer and more absorbent than cotton, under the Mush name. In January 2022 GlobalBees, the house of brands that buys and scales online-first products, bought the company.

  19. MyClassCampus
    Bought by
    Teachmint
    When
    January 2022
    For
    Undisclosed

    Rachit Dave, Rutvij Vora and Raj Kothari started MyClassCampus in 2017, a campus ERP that ran a school's admissions, fees, payroll and parent communication from one app. In January 2022 Teachmint, the Bengaluru education infrastructure company, bought it as its fourth acquisition, pairing the ERP with its own learning management system for institutions. Terms were not disclosed.

  20. Scouto
    Bought by
    Spinny
    When
    February 2022
    For
    Undisclosed

    Akshay Gupta and Shubham Sharma built Scouto at DevX: a connected-car device and app that reads a car's health and links the owner to service, insurance and FASTag providers, backed by DevX Venture Fund, iCreate and the Bhuva family office. In February 2022 Spinny, the used-car retailer, bought 100% of it. Scouto had done about Rs 5 crore of revenue that year.

  21. Glib
    Bought by
    Cygnet Infotech, a majority
    When
    March 2022
    For
    Undisclosed

    Dr Mohit Shah and Purav Parekh started Glib to pull data out of documents, invoices, forms and contracts, with machine learning that reads a page by position, context and structure. In March 2022 Cygnet Infotech, the Ahmedabad technology company, bought a majority stake, an exit inside the city, with the founders continuing to run it.

  22. Volansys Technologies
    Bought by
    ACL Digital
    When
    April 2022
    For
    Undisclosed

    Volansys did product engineering from Ahmedabad for companies from startups to the Fortune 500: design, development, validation and manufacturing of connected devices for industrial and home automation, networking, healthcare and consumer electronics. In April 2022 ACL Digital, part of the French engineering group ALTEN, bought the company for an undisclosed sum to add that depth in IoT to its own services.

  23. Veirdo
    Bought by
    TMRW, a majority
    When
    November 2022
    For
    Part of Rs 289 crore across eight brands

    Amardeep Jadeja, Piyush Ganatra and Dhaval Ahir started Veirdo in 2015, affordable streetwear for young men sold through the marketplaces, and it had grown twentyfold by 2021. In November 2022 TMRW, Aditya Birla Group's house of digital-first brands, took majority stakes in eight labels for Rs 289 crore in all, and Veirdo was the one from Ahmedabad.

  24. Veeksha
    Bought by
    Adda247
    When
    June 2023
    For
    Undisclosed

    Gaurishankar Singh, Hariprasad Bommidi and Miral Songhela started Veeksha in 2021, 3D lessons in maths and science that a student could turn over on a phone. Two years later Adda247, the Google-backed test-prep company, bought it to put 3D, AR and VR into its K-12 and JEE/NEET courses; it said the students using the material engaged 30% more. Terms were not disclosed.

  25. Tirex Chargers
    Bought by
    Gulf Oil Lubricants, 51%
    When
    August 2023
    For
    Rs 103 crore

    Tirex makes DC fast chargers for electric vehicles, from 30 kW to 240 kW, at a plant in Naroda GIDC, and had put more than 400 of them on the ground for public sector operators, charge point companies and bus makers. In August 2023 Gulf Oil Lubricants India, the Hinduja group company, agreed to buy 51% for Rs 103 crore, its way from lubricants into charging. Tirex had done Rs 13 crore of revenue the year before.

  26. Pirimid Fintech
    Bought by
    Infibeam Avenues, 49%
    When
    December 2023
    For
    Rs 25 crore

    Nirav Prajapati started Pirimid in 2017 to build trading and lending software for banks and brokers; Bank of Baroda, Lendingkart and BidFX, a subsidiary of the Singapore Exchange, were among the clients. In December 2023 Infibeam Avenues, the Ahmedabad payments company, bought 49% for Rs 25 crore to take its payments business into the capital markets. Pirimid had grown revenue 39% to Rs 13.8 crore the year before.

  27. Clientjoy
    Bought by
    Synup
    When
    January 2024
    For
    Undisclosed

    Yash Shah, Anupama Panchal, Abhishek Doshi and Shashwat Bhatt started Clientjoy in 2019 as a CRM for agencies and freelancers, proposals, contracts, invoices and a client portal in one place, and raised $800,000 from GVFL in 2020. By the time Synup, the American local-marketing software company, bought it in January 2024 it had 16,000 customers in 90 countries. Co-founder Anupama Panchal moved to Synup with the product. Terms were not disclosed.

  28. Shy Tiger Brands
    Bought by
    Ghost Kitchens India
    When
    April 2024
    For
    Undisclosed

    Milapsinh Jadeja started Shy Tiger in 2018 and ran five multi-brand cloud kitchens across Ahmedabad, with KBOB's and The Black Chimney the names people ordered. In April 2024 Ghost Kitchens India, the GVFL-backed cloud kitchen company, bought it to run its own brands out of Shy Tiger's kitchens and expand across Gujarat; Jadeja invested in Ghost Kitchens' funding round in turn.

  29. Lendingkart
    Bought by
    Fullerton Financial, a controlling stake
    When
    October 2024
    For
    Rs 252 crore

    Harshvardhan Lunia and Mukul Sachan started Lendingkart in Ahmedabad in 2014 to lend working capital to small businesses on data rather than collateral. In October 2024 Fullerton Financial Holdings, the Temasek subsidiary that already held 38.1% of the company, agreed to put in Rs 252 crore and become the majority, controlling shareholder, subject to regulatory approval, to scale its MSME lending. The founders' company became a subsidiary of its investor.

  30. Navkar Digital Institute
    Bought by
    Veranda Learning, 65%
    When
    February 2025
    For
    Rs 45.5 crore

    Navkar Institute has taught chartered accountancy in Ahmedabad since 1997, when Jigar Shah started it, and Navkar Digital is the arm that takes CA, CS and CMA coaching to students in smaller towns by distance learning. In February 2025 the listed education company Veranda Learning bought 65% for Rs 45.5 crore and folded it into JK Shah Classes, buying a stake in BB Virtuals in the same announcement.

  31. SocialPilot
    Bought by
    group.one
    When
    July 2025
    For
    Over $50 million

    Jimit Bagadiya and Tejas Mehta, college friends, started SocialPilot in 2014 as a tool for small businesses and agencies to plan, publish and report on social media posts, and built it without venture capital into a product used by around 13,000 companies. On 10 July 2025 group.one, the Swedish hosting and software group with two million customers in fifteen countries, agreed to buy it for over $50 million, reported at Rs 400 crore, to add marketing automation to its tools for small businesses.

  32. InnKey
    Bought by
    Yanolja
    When
    May 2026
    For
    Undisclosed

    Viral Shah started InnKey in Ahmedabad in 2011, with Rohan Shah joining to take it further: a hotel ERP on the cloud that runs front office, restaurants, purchasing, accounts and guest messaging for mid-scale chains, on more than 500 hotels across India. On 7 May 2026 Yanolja, the South Korean travel technology company, bought it through Yanolja Cloud Solution, extending a partnership the two already had, with a plan to take InnKey into the Middle East and Southeast Asia. Terms were not disclosed.

  33. Dermatouch
    Bought by
    Wipro Consumer Care, 60%
    When
    August 2026
    For
    Rs 387.5 crore enterprise value

    Anish Nagpal and Amit Purswani started Dermatouch in 2021, dermatologist-tested skincare sold online, and grew it to Rs 131 crore of revenue in FY26, up 114% in a year. In August 2026 Wipro Consumer Care and Lighting bought 60% at an enterprise value of Rs 387.5 crore, its entry into premium skincare and its 18th acquisition worldwide, with the rest of the stake to follow over three years and the founders continuing to run the brand.
